  • Abstract
    The stability of neural network controllers for a class of plants is studied. With the use of the passivity theorem, the stability region of the weight coefficients can be derived and hence sufficient conditions for a stable neural network controller can be obtained. Once these conditions are satisfied, a stable neural network controller can be designed easily
